Output 3b66700d792d07bd8951d6d5008e6834d435e09f8c67e8906181bdc215c9ab1b:2

value
197763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 442c9f9545d4b417229c470e9b1b9130859666bf OP_EQUALVERIFY OP_CHECKSIG
address
17DUQXnBnM9LjoSsy71f7Z3j2TXLYb2hvw
transaction
3b66700d792d07bd8951d6d5008e6834d435e09f8c67e8906181bdc215c9ab1b
spent
true